I'm too lazy to read all comments but want to tell you that issue with your Sustain usually happens when lube in roller bearing becomes too sticky (due to sand or water or grease leaked inside the roller bearing). Usually it could be easily fixed by re-oiling the roller bearing. It's better to use Shimano oils (I had bad experience with other oils - they become too sticky on low temperatures and roller bearing fails again).

That anti reverse issue has happened to me on a $20 reel and the issue was a simple lack of grease. Cant tell you how many times I had a big lake trout on and would let go of the handle to have it backfire. Then when I took the time to open it up and see that it was lacking grease and would sometimes get stuck open, I was laughing as I greased it and have had no problems since, its my Dads reel and it still works 2yrs after repair.

I've been a big fan of the Penn Fierce since its introduction. Amazing reel for the price. I currently have a 3000 and 2500 model of the second generation. The only thing I didn't like about the first generation Fierce was that ridge that was on the part that goes on the reel seat of a rod. That gave me a lot of discomfort on my right middle finger while holding the rod during fishing. The only occasional issue I've had with my current Fierce II reels is the tightness of the bearings. That happens only if the reel has gotten wet for a long enough period of time, such as rainy days or waves constantly soaking it. But as long as it fully dries and I give it a decent amount of cranking, it's back to normal.
